How Do Real-World Factors Impact TST Moped Range?
Rider weight (+20% drain per 50lbs over 180), headwinds (15% loss), hills (25% loss), throttle vs PAS (50% difference) slash published ranges 30-50%. Cold drops 20%.

What Charging Strategies Extend Daily Riding?
Charge to 80% daily, store at 50% Li-ion health, 4A fast chargers cut time to 3 hours; dual packs rotate for 200+ mile days. Avoid full discharges.
